## Deployment

Telemetry out of Wispbarrel gets chunky fast, so we compress payloads before they leave the agent. We use streaming compression with a tunable level — crank it too high and the edge boxes burn CPU; too low and the uplink saturates during peak hours. If you're redeploying, don't guess at the knobs; the current tuning took weeks to settle. The values production runs with today are these.

deployment values, yadug-bawif:
[framir]
team = pelox
access_code = ac_a38ab2
owner = tamion.julael
host = framir.tolvaqlabs.test
port = 11211
peer = tammir.zemvargrid.local
salt = 2215ef03
pin = 1541

**Vendor note: Inkmill markdown pipeline**

Rendering for Parchway docs is outsourced to Inkmill under an annual contract, renewing each March. They handle sanitization and PDF export; we own the upload queue. SLA: 4-hour response on rendering failures. Escalate only after two failed retries. Their support desk is reachable at the address below.

billing contact of hahaf-baguf = zorael.tammir.jorius@sivrelhq.internal

Handover — Fernwheel transcode farm

Hey, passing the Fernwheel farm over to you. Workers are stable, but the GPU pool in the Ostlake zone runs hot on 4K jobs, so keep an eye on the queue depth. Plugin authors keep asking about preset limits — point them at the docs, not me. The current farm configuration they build against is the following.

service settings:
PRAIX_LOG_LEVEL=error
PRAIX_METRICS_HOST=metrics.praix.qorvelcorp.corp
PRAIX_POOL_SIZE=16

## Spreadsheet Export: Memory Notes

The Ledgerloom export service streams rows rather than buffering whole workbooks, so memory stays flat for most jobs. The exception is exports with merged-cell formatting, which force a full sheet hold in memory. If a pod exceeds its limit, check for merged-cell jobs first. When escalating, reference the service build token printed below.

build token for kagaf-hahof: htk14_9d3d4d26d7d8de

TURN-208: Gatevale turnstile counters at the Merrow Field pilot double-count when a rotation reverses mid-cycle. Attendance totals drift roughly 2% high per event. The debounce window fix is implemented, reviewed by Ilsa, and soak-tested across two simulated match days without drift. Ready for your cut; the candidate build is identified below.

trace token, tagag-tafog: htk6_5ed18c